Trump administration imposes steel, aluminum tariffs on Canada, Mexico, EU
On May 31, U.S. Commerce Secretary Wilbur Ross said that negotiations over how to address American security concerns over imported steel and aluminum from North American and European allies have not been satisfactorily addressed, and that earlier announced tariffs of 25% on imported steel and 10% on imported aluminum....
